2010-01-01から1年間の記事一覧

誤診について

http://anond.hatelabo.jp/20100816114659 こんなんを見たのでこの前の誤診を書く。この前腹痛で病院に行ったら盲腸と判断された(実際には盲腸ではなかった)。 結論から書くと盲腸ではなく、自然に治る腹痛 ただ、盲腸は判断が難しいらしく、昔なら切って…

EasyBotter cron対応

blogが更新されたらつぶやくように修正同じものをつぶやかないように管理してやるこんな感じに適当な管理用テーブルを作成して管理 管理ID つぶやいたBlog_id 時刻 1 100 XXXX-YY-ZZ 2 101 XXXX-YY-ZZ アバウトに更新されたものから10件とってきて まだつぶ…

EasyBotter つぶやく内容編集

前回つぶやけるように設定して OAuthの設定をしたので次はつぶやく内容の編集をします。つぶやくのはこのスクリプト post_random.php post_rotation.php まあ、テキスト読み込んでランダムにするか、回すかの違いなんで どっちを編集してもOK。 編集したら捨…

EasyBotter1.4 OAuth対応

Basic認証なのでOAuthに対応させる参考 http://www26.atwiki.jp/easybotter_wiki/pages/23.html http://d.hatena.ne.jp/hebita164/20100425/1272210734oauth_test.txtを入手 http://www.sdn-project.net/labo/oauth_test.txt0.2.0-beta3をダウンロード http:…

DLする

http://pha22.net/twitterbot/file/easybotter1.42.zip解凍してファイルの編集。 各PHPファイルにIDとPASSを入力後はサーバにUploadする。 改行コードをLFに変更してpost_random.phpを叩けば動作確認完了ちゃんとPOSTされてることを確認 https://twitter.com…

ツイッターBOT 再トライ 

調べて見るとSTABLE版の1.4ならうごくっぽいので再度挑戦する。

ファイルをアップロードする

用意したサーバーにファイルをアップロード そしてdata.txtとreply_pattern.phpとlog.datのパーミッションを666に設定。 public_html/bot/PEAR/HTTP/OAuth/Consumer/Request.php on line 214どうやらハッスルサーバでは↑が出て動かない模様。しょうがないか…

setting.phpの編集

ログインできるように編集する。 $screen_name = ""; //botのid名 $consumer_key = ""; // Consumer keyの値 $consumer_secret = ""; // Consumer secretの値 $access_token = ""; // Access Tokenの値 $access_token_secret = ""; // Access Token Secretの…

OAuTHの認証用キーをGETする

BOT用のIDを取得して http://dev.twitter.com/apps/ にアクセスするアプリケーション名: アイマスあんてなBOT アプリケーションの説明: アイドルマスター声優のBlogの更新チェックをして、更新されたものがあればキャラ風につぶやくBOT アプリケーションのウ…

解凍する。

てきとうな解凍ソフトで解凍

DLする

http://pha22.net/twitterbot/file/EasyBotter2.04beta.zip

使用制限

特にありません。商用利用も可能です。スクリプトの改造、再配布など何でも構いません。 と書いてあるので、改造して使うことにする。とりあえず、動かして見てソースを読むかな。動かし方

ツイッターBOTを作る

TwitterのBOTを作ってみる。さくっと調べたらこんなのがあったんでこれを使う。 プログラミングができなくても作れるTwitter botの作り方 http://pha22.net/twitterbot/2.0/setting.php

対NHK完結編

解決したので解決編書きます。今日の12時に電話をかけると言っていたのに なぜか朝9:45分に電話がかかってくる。完全に寝てたんで、寝起きの状態で出ると後30分したらかけなおすと 言われたんで、起きる準備をする。 で、再度電話が。前の○○さんによって契約…

NHK 解約編

契約してしまったのは不覚だけど あいつだけは許せねえってことで、解約手続きをすることにしました。 あいつの給料の一部になるものを払うくらいなら テレビを見るのを当面やめる。 契約する寸前に脅して契約させるのはやめてください といったら、そんなこ…

NHKとの戦いまとめ

NHKは色々あって腹たってたんで そんなやつらの給料なんて払ってやるかと思ってたんだが 集金係がどんどん強くなってきて今日は親玉みたいな人が来た やりとりまとめ まずNHKの放送受信契約義務について説明 (ここでものすごい払わないと法的手段に訴えると…

萌えビジネス本

「もし高校野球の女子マネージャーがドラッカーの『マネジメント』を読んだら 」 表紙に惹かれて買ってしまった ってのはまあ事実なんだけど。話題になっててマネジメントに興味があったんで読んでみた。 ちょっと前にQ&Aのサイトにてこんな質問を見ていて …

デザインをがんばる

RSSを取得して、DBに突っ込んだので いい感じに表示させる。背景と文字の組み合わせについて http://www.kanzaki.com/docs/html/color-check3カラムにしてみた。アイマスあんてな http://galant.arrow.jp/imas/index.phpあんてなさいとっぽいもの作成完了コ…

DBから日別に取得してループさせる。datetime型の扱いに苦戦中PHPで日付の計算 http://phpspot.net/php/pg%8D%F0%93%FA%81E%8D%A1%93%FA%82̓%FA%95t%82%F0%8E擾.html http://phpspot.net/php/portal/cv/index.php?m=source&c=01&s=6e75664d126ff8c17285440b3…

rssをパースしてデータベースに入れる

そもそも今のRSSの配信形式は3つあるらしい RSS1.0 RSS2.0 ATOMそれぞれXMLの名前空間の定義が違ってて非常にめんどくさい 強引に全部に対応させる対応できてなかったらその都度処理をいれるという無茶な仕様 まあ、今回はアイマス声優のみを対象だからこれ…

あとは思いつきで作る。

RSSをデータベースに登録する部分をつくった 表に出ないのですっごい適当なページをテーブルを作成admin.php <br> <form action="<?=$_SERVER[ "PHP_SELF" ]?>" method="POST"> ブログの名前<br> <input size="100" type="text" name="name"></input><br> RSSのURL<br> <input size="200" type="text" name="url"></input><br>

作るファイル

ファイル名 役割 index.php メインのページ get_rss.php Cronでrssをとってくるスクリプト

画面はオワタあんてなっぽく作る。

データベースはこんな感じで大丈夫かな。

記事管理用 カラム名 役割 ID プライマリID BlogID 管理用に振られてるblogID date 記事が書かれた日付 title 記事タイトル link 記事へのリンク description 記事の中身 encoded 記事の中身をいじってあるもの ブログ管理用 カラム名 役割 blogid ブログのI…

RSS収集するcronは1日1回でいいかな。

ブログアンテナサイトを構築する

まず開発環境をつくるサクラエディタ